Third Annual Gilbert Lake Triathlon, July 2, 2022.  Group photo above.

Swimming In the lake started at 8:00 AM at Meyer’s dock.
Again this year we had fun!  Started and finished at Meyer’s dock after swimming to the trampoline in front of Karlgaards/Whitemans.  For some, it was ferrying out to the trampoline and then swimming back to Meyer’s dock.
Bikes  headed down McKay, through Northtown, turned right on Beaver Dam, turned right onto the Paul Bunyan Trail, turned right onto Wise Rd, turned right onto Riverside, turned right onto McKay and ended up back at Meyer's/Ryan’s driveway. (About a 9-mile bike ride)
Running was to the cul-de-sac at the far end of Birchwood Lane, then back the way they came.  Took a left onto Andberg Way, then a right onto North Oak Drive, and then take a final right on McKay. Finished to lots of cheering at the “T” at Birchwood and McKay. Way to go! They did it!  
This was a very friendly event with complimentary popsicles.

​July 3, 2021:  The Gilbert Lake Association Second Annual Triathlon.  Swimming, biking and running.

Fallon Ryan was the women's class winner with a time of 54.5 minutes.

Andy Rangen was declared the men's class winner and overall winner with a time of 49.5 minutes.

Congratulations to all who competed.  It was a great social gathering too.


Friday, July 3, 2020:  The First Annual Gilbert Lake Association Triathlon was held.  Those gathered are seen below.

 Andy Rangen was first with a time of 102.45.  The Jacobson team came in at 103.10, John Lynn had 103.45 and Fallon Ryan had 104.43.  It was so much fun that the group decided to do the event next year.
